Autapomorphies of Bryconaethiops macrops View in CoL :
1. Degree of ventral curvature of lateral line (90): (1> 0) straight or only slightly curved, with posterior portion aligned with middle caudal-fin rays. Reversal of synapomorphy 3 of the Alestidae .
2. Number of rows of premaxillary teeth (123): (0> 1) three. Paralleled in the Bryconinae and in Chalceus macrolepidotus .
3. Rows of gill rakers on first ceratobranchial (192): (0> 1) two. Reversal of synapomorphy 3 of node 179. Paralleled in the Iguanodectinae , in node 280, and in Brycon orbignyanus , Carlana eigenmanni , Cheirodon interruptus , Hoplocharax goethei , Hyphessobrycon elachys , Odontostilbe microcephala , Parecbasis cyclolepis , Prodontocharax melanotus , and Rhaphiodon vulpinus . Some trees: Paralleled in node 249 and in Attonitus ephimeros .
4. Pelvic bone (260): (0> 1) bifurcate with conspicuous notch.
5. Number of supraneurals (280): (1> 0) four or fewer. Paralleled in nodes 211, 223, and 262 and in Bramocharax bransfordii , Hyphessobrycon bifasciatus , and Nematocharax venustus . Some trees: Paralleled in the Aphyoditeinae .
